Understanding the Real Cost of Stock Issues
Stock problems affect far more than inventory counts. Every inventory mistake creates financial consequences that extend throughout the business.
Running out of inventory means losing immediate sales while also reducing product visibility within Amazon's search algorithm. Customers who cannot purchase today often choose competing products instead, making it difficult to recover those lost sales later.
Excess inventory creates different challenges. Long-term storage fees, warehouse costs, insurance expenses, and tied-up working capital reduce overall profitability. Products that remain unsold for extended periods may also become obsolete, requiring discounts that further reduce margins.
Inventory inaccuracies create additional operational inefficiencies. Customer service teams spend more time resolving order issues, warehouse staff manage unnecessary adjustments, and finance departments struggle with inaccurate inventory valuations.

Forecasting Helps Prevent Inventory Problems
Inventory forecasting has evolved from simple historical analysis into sophisticated predictive planning.
Instead of reacting after inventory problems occur, businesses can anticipate future demand based on historical sales patterns, market trends, supplier lead times, promotional campaigns, and seasonal buying behavior.
Accurate forecasting enables companies to purchase inventory with greater confidence while improving warehouse planning and cash flow management.
Businesses that forecast effectively reduce excess inventory while maintaining sufficient stock for expected customer demand.
This balanced approach lowers storage expenses, minimizes inventory write-offs, and improves customer satisfaction through consistent product availability.
Modern forecasting also helps organizations prepare for supply chain disruptions by identifying potential inventory shortages before they become operational problems.

Managing Multi-Channel Inventory More Efficiently
Many Amazon sellers now operate across multiple ecommerce platforms including Shopify, Walmart, eBay, and emerging marketplaces.
Managing inventory independently for each platform creates duplicate work while increasing the risk of overselling.
Centralized inventory management solves this challenge by maintaining synchronized inventory across every connected sales channel.
Whenever a product sells on one marketplace, inventory updates automatically across all channels.
This unified approach significantly improves operational efficiency while reducing inventory discrepancies.
Businesses gain complete visibility into total inventory rather than maintaining separate inventory counts for individual platforms.
